Transaction 18555d76815497433a26705a714092c930f4ded17ed05fac36159d2e3344eeda
1 Input
1 Output
-
18555d76815497433a26705a714092c930f4ded17ed05fac36159d2e3344eeda:0
- value
- 1731589
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ef949b2a0bf5b53a43072c151dfa81eb8af8c52a OP_EQUAL
- address
- 3PXoSizRxDATLFhxHFGRduiXF3Fn69NT1k